Tourists are being encouraged to visit regional Western Australia, but who is there to greet them and ensure they have a great experience once they arrive?
Mullewa Community Resource Centre (CRC) receives support from the Department of Primary Industries and Regional Development, but it has operated the visitor centre for 12 years without additional government funding.
Staff say that responsibility could soon fall to local businesses due to budget and resource pressures.
Up to 150 people come through the doors every day and almost 5,000 tourists access the centre's services during this year's wildflower season.
